Experience with a 82Sr/82Rb generator for clinical use. 1987

M J Kensett, and P L Horlock, and S L Waters, and D M Bateman

A 82Sr/82Rb generator system is described which is shown to be suitable for continuous intravenous infusion in man. The breakthrough of the 82Sr parent has been closely monitored and remained less than 18.5 Bq mL-1 of infusate. A method using a 0.05% solution of sodium hypochlorite to disinfect the generator resulted in a sterile and pyrogen free eluate. Recommendations are made for the setting up of the generator to ensure the maintenance of its pharmaceutical integrity.

D011829 Radiation Dosage The amount of radiation energy that is deposited in a unit mass of material, such as tissues of plants or animal. In RADIOTHERAPY, radiation dosage is expressed in gray units (Gy). In RADIOLOGIC HEALTH, the dosage is expressed by the product of absorbed dose (Gy) and quality factor (a function of linear energy transfer), and is called radiation dose equivalent in sievert units (Sv). D011876 Radionuclide Generators Separation systems containing a relatively long-lived parent radionuclide which produces a short-lived daughter in its decay scheme. The daughter can be periodically extracted (milked) by means of an appropriate eluting agent.
